Rafael,

If you are talking about the piston Duke V2, the winglets are controlled by the title in the aircraft cfg. title=RealAir Beech Duke V2 S5CEA Winglets without title=RealAir Beech Duke V2 N820MH. If your talking about the Turbine Duke v2. I do not know; they all should have the winglets.

Thanks for the answers guys.

After long troubleshooting I've found the solution and will post it here for future's sake.

The winglets (and ventral stakes) were missing because of a gauge not found on my edited panel.cfg, it's the gaugexx=Config!ModelOptions, 1020, 1023, 1, 1.

This gauge activates the ModelOptions.xml file found in the CONFIG folder inside the panel folder of the Turbine Duke, which controls the winglets and ventral strakes of the aircraft.
